A one-liner from Minneapolis Star Tribune columnist Sid Hartman says that former University of Utah center Michael Doleac, who will be in town when the Minnesota Timbewolves visit the Jazz on Wednesday, "wants to finish the season (in Minnesota) and hasn't decided whether he will play after this year."
Ex-Hawks point guard Tyronn Lue, waived last Friday by Sacramento, told the Atlanta Journal-Constitution he will soon sign with Dallas to back up Kidd. Lue had not yet cleared waivers, so he did not dress for Dallas against the Jazz on Monday.
MILESTONE: On this date in 1996, Jazz point guard John Stockton dished 11 assists in a win over Phoenix to become the first player in NBA history with 11,000 assists.
